The 5G Acceleration team is a mission-focused organization, working across the company to create, build, and deliver Private and Neutral Host Networks that will propel customer transformations. Our indirect business is growing rapidly so we are looking for an experienced Senior Manager, Sales Ops & Enablement to be responsible for the overall governance and operations of this increasingly important sales channel. You are a seasoned professional, renowned for your ability to manage complex indirect sales activities including tracking orders, billing and general support, and proactively identifying strategic opportunities for improvement and growth. You have a deep understanding of channel enablement and a proven track record of delivering in a high-impact, dynamic and sometimes ambiguous environment where you can build enduring strategic relationships, drive significant sales growth through innovative programs, and influence outcomes across senior-level teams. Benefits and CompensationOur benefits are designed to help you move forward in your career, and in areas of your life outside of Verizon. From health and wellness benefit options including: medical, dental, vision, short and long term disability, basic life insurance, supplemental life insurance, AD&D insurance, identity theft protection, pet insurance and group home & auto insurance. We also offer a matched 401(k) savings plan, stock incentive programs, up to 8 company paid holidays per year and up to 6 personal days per year, parental leave, adoption assistance and tuition assistance, plus other incentives, we've got you covered with our award-winning total rewards package. Depending on the role, employees have the opportunity to receive compensation in the form of premium pay such as overtime, shift differential, holiday pay, allowances, etc. Newly hired employees receive up to 15 days of vacation per year, which grows with additional service. For part-timers, your coverage will vary as you may be eligible for some of these benefits depending on your individual circumstances. The salary will vary depending on your location and confirmed job-related skills and experience. This is an incentive based position with the potential to earn more. For part-time roles, your compensation will be adjusted to reflect your hours. The annual salary range for the location(s) listed on this job requisition based on a full-time schedule is: $104,500.00 - $200,000.00. The annual salary range for the Colorado location(s) listed on this job requisition based on a full-time schedule is: $115,000.00 - $200,000.00. The annual salary range for the Illinois location(s) listed on this job requisition based on a full-time schedule is: $115,000.00 - $200,000.00. |
